Combustion system for industrial boiler is a complicated time-varying and dynamic process, with obvious non-linearity, tight coupling, long time lags and strong interference. So it is hard to achieve ideal control performance and higher rate of automatic operation with conventional control arithmetic. Generalized predictive control(GPC) method, generalized predictive control with proportion and integration structure(PIGPC) method and grey generalized predictive control (GGPC) method are used in this paper to control the water level and combustion system. The performance of this new control system is analyzed in this paper and the simulation results show that this new control method has better robustness, quick tracking and good resistant disturbances. So based on these advanced control methods, the industrial boiler control system introduced in this paper can get good regulation quality, enhance combustion efficiency and realize energy-saving, which not only has value on academic study but also has remarkable economic benefit and social benefit.
